An Israeli university professor, Yolanda Yavor, has initiated a hunger strike in response to her arrest for calling Prime Minister Benjamin Netanyahu a “traitor.” Detained for allegedly inciting violence through Facebook posts, Yavor, a lecturer at Tel Aviv University, is currently held at the Kishon detention facility. Her lawyer claims the investigation is politically motivated and that she poses no threat, while Netanyahu’s office has not commented on her arrest.
